Certificate of Analysis
Sample used in the preparation of this reference material was collected in 1968 from the Braggtown Quary near Durham, North Carolina. The material is one of the Triassic-Jurassic olivine-normative dolerites indigenous to the area (Ragland, et al., 1968).
Element concentrations were determined by cooperating laboratories using a variety of analytical methods. Certificate values are based primarily on USGS results (Flanagan, 1984) and international data compilations (Gladney and Roelandts, 1987, Govindaraju, 1994). | Oxide | Wt % | ± | Oxide | Wt % | ± |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| SiO2 | 47.15 | 0.21 | Na2O | 1.89 | 0.057 | |
| Al2O3 | 18.34 | 0.17 | K2O | 0.234 | 0.009 | |
| CaO | 11.49 | 0.07 | MnO | 0.15 | 0.003 | |
| MgO | 10.13 | 0.11 | P2O5 | 0.07 | 0.005 | |
| FeO | 7.32 | 0.06 | TiO2 | 0.48 | 0.007 | |
| Fe2O3 | 1.79 | 0.11 | Fe2O3T | 9.97 | 0.15 |
| Element | µg/g | ± | Element | µg/g | ± |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Ba | 118 | 11 | Sb | 0.96 | 0.03 | |
| Co | 57 | 2.2 | Sc | 31 | 1 | |
| Cr | 270 | 8.5 | Sr | 144 | 1.8 | |
| Cu | 100 | 2.6 | V | 148 | 8.3 | |
| Eu | 0.59 | 0.03 | Y | 18 | 0.8 | |
| La | 3.6 | 0.30 | Yb | 2 | 0.1 | |
| Li | 5.2 | 0.29 | Zn | 70 | 2.4` | |
| Nd | 5.2 | 0.56 | Zr | 38 | 1 | |
| Ni | 247 | 12 | ||||
| Element | µg/g | Element | µg/g |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| As | 0.12 | Ga | 15 | |
| B | 0.9 | Gd | 2 | |
| Be | 1 | Ho | 0.62 | |
| Cl | 60 | Nb | 3 | |
| Dy | 3 | Pb | 6.3 | |
| F | 66 | Rb | 4.5 |

Flanagan, F.J., 1984, Three USGS Mafic Rock Reference Samples, W-2, DNC-1, and BIR-1: U.S. Geological Survey Bulletin 1623, p. 54.
Gladney, E.S., and Roelandts, I., 1988, 1987 Compilation of Elemental Concentration Data for USGS BIR-1, DNC-1, and W-2: Geostandards Newsletter, 12: 63-118
Govindaraju, K., 1994, 1994 Compilation of Working Values and Descriptions for 383 Geostandards: Geostandards Newsletter, 18:1-158
Ragland, P.C., Rogers, J.J.W., and Justus, P.S., 1968, Origin and Differentiation of Triassic Dolerite Magmans, North Carolina, USA: Contributions to Mineralogy and Petrology, vol. 20. no. 1, pp. 57-80.
| Symbol | Definition |
|---|---|
| Fe2O3T | Total iron expressed as Fe2O3 |
| Ctot | Total carbon concentration |
| Stot | Total sulfur concentration |
| Wt % | Percent of total element concentration |
| µg/g | Total element concentration expressed as micrograms of element per gram of solid sample |
| ± | One standard deviation |
Unless otherwise indicated total element concentrations are reported for material on an as-received basis, i.e., no drying.
